Job Description

Responsible for the management of the product lifecycle from project definition/scope through implementation. Works with Business Owners, Stakeholders, Project Management, Operations, SMEs and one or more teams to identify product features and enhancements to new and existing products, services, and tools, and well as production fixes. Guides and supports teams by owning the vision for a release, deciding the priority and details of features to build, accepting features after satisfactory demonstration of development and testing, and accepting the implementation release.

What You'll Do

* Applies domain knowledge and seeks direct customer and Business Owner feedback to make sure implemented features meet customer needs

* Works cross-functionally with product marketing to assure that product launches effectively, including the appropriate training, sales support, communications, and clear product positioning

* Works cross-functionally with multiple departments to assure all functional areas are vetted for impacts and supplementary requirements

* Demonstrates a mastery of the domain to envision a product and articulates the vision to the team and other stakeholders

* Helps shape the product and/or platform roadmap, defines scope, participates in estimation efforts, and prioritizes initiatives

* Coordinates finding answers to technical questions on the domain for those developing and testing the product

* Creates the product roadmap and describes the product with understanding of users and use, and a product that best serves both

* Communicates vision and intent, and helps the business owner understand feasibility of certain functionality in order to prioritize and reduce non-essential scope

* Facilitates Sprint planning sessions to ensure proper understanding of requirements, the need for resource specialists, and team commitment to completing user stories and tasks in a given sprint

* Post release, responsible for tracking and reporting on whether the envisioned business value is realized

* Understands business case, project scope, and current processes as compared to future processes

* Develops requirements, user stories, and acceptance criteria to confirm alignment with product vision

* Identifies and reports any quality of compliance concerns and takes immediate corrective action as required

* Leads development efforts by capturing business context/problem, client needs, current state, desired future state, objectives, and impacted user groups

* Elaborates user stories and prepares the product backlog for sprint planning and release planning

* Elaborates features and stories to provide adequate input to the design process

* Works with team members and managers to ensure access to proper environments for each stage of development, testing, and release

* Communicates the upcoming need for specific resources for certain timeframes based on user story prioritization and solution/impact analyst recommendations

* Ensures requirements are specified in a manner suitable for the intended audience and are understood, unambiguous, and capable of being implemented and tested

* Assesses change requests related to requirements and user stories to assess overall impact. Responsible for ensuring change control and change management procedures are followed as they relate to requirements

* Serves vital role in the product design process prior to project initiation; serves as an enterprise level subject matter expert for assistance in vetting product design concepts, communicating potential enterprise impacts in relation to the design and helps to continuously improve the design through to completion

* Identifies methodology challenges and recommends solutions for continuously evolving Agile at BCBSNC.

What You'll Bring (Hiring Requirements)

*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Business Administration or a related discipline and eight years of applicable experience (business analyst, project management, technical analyst, solutions architect, etc.).

* In lieu of a Bachelor's degree, 10 years of applicable experience (business analyst, project management, technical analyst, solutions architect, etc.) is required.

* Demonstrated experience writing and reviewing business, user, functional and nonfunctional requirements.

* Adept at gathering requirements and acceptance from stakeholders, sponsors, clients, and user community.

* Proficient at creating strong relationships that foster the spirit of innovation, improvement, and collaborative solutions and developments.

* Proficient with tracking and managing multiple projects working with a variety of cross-functional resources

* Familiar with Agile Scrum methodology and rapid application development techniques
